How much do wordpress ass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 29, 2026, the average hourly pay for wordpress assistant in the United States is $18.95,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.14 and $21.15 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Wordpress Assistant position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Wordpress Assistant, you need a good grasp of Wordpress website management, basic HTML/CSS, content publishing, and troubleshooting common technical issues. Familiarity with plugins, themes, website analytics tools, and possibly certifications in web content management systems are valuable.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and effective communication set candidates apart in this role. These skills ensure smooth website operations, accurate content updates, and effective coordination with web teams or clients.

What is a WordPress Assistant job?

A WordPress Assistant is responsible for helping manage, update, and optimize WordPress websites. Their tasks may include content updates, plugin and theme management, basic troubleshooting, and site performance improvements. They often assist with SEO, security measures, and ensuring a smooth user experience. The role requires familiarity with WordPress's backend, basic HTML/CSS knowledge, and attention to detail.

What types of tasks and responsibilities can I expect as a Wordpress Assistant on a daily basis?

As a Wordpress Assistant, your daily tasks will likely involve updating website content, uploading images, formatting blog posts, and ensuring that pages display correctly across devices. You may assist with managing plugins and themes, troubleshooting minor site issues, and coordinating with developers or designers for more complex updates. Many Wordpress Assistants also monitor website analytics, respond to user inquiries, and maintain up-to-date documentation on website procedures. This role often provides opportunities to learn new technical skills and can serve as a stepping stone toward more advanced web development or digital marketing positions.

Position Information

The Digital Content Student Assistant, under general supervision, will support Texas A&M AgriLife Marketing and Communication's event promotion process from start to finish.

The student worker will create event advances, select appropriate image(s) to accompany both the event advance and calendar entry, upload event advance and images to WordPress, develop calendar entry and aid in the distribution of event advance to media channels via Cision. This role is open only to current Texas A&M University students.

Day-to-day activities will vary and you may be asked to help with other tasks and working collaboratively with team members on projects.

All AgriLife Marketing and Communications student workers complete a project aligned with the AgriLife Marketing and Communications strategic plan, creating a small-scale campaign or initiative using the PESO model. Projects vary by role and may be implemented in real-world applications, providing portfolio-ready work.
